Textile Market Dynamics in Asia - Israel

Navigating the intersection of Mediterranean climate and high-end fashion demands.

Israel's textile market is heavily influenced by its unique geographical position and scorching summers. There is a critical demand for garment fabric that offers breathability without compromising on durability, especially for corporate and formal wear in Tel Aviv and Jerusalem.

The local industry is currently shifting toward "Smart Textiles." With increasing temperatures, the adoption of specialized linings like acetate lining fabric has grown, providing a silk-like feel with better moisture management for high-end tailoring.

Furthermore, the religious and cultural diversity in the region drives a steady demand for modest yet lightweight attire, where chiffon lining fabric is frequently utilized to add opacity while maintaining a sheer, airy aesthetic.

Market Development History

In the 1980s and 90s, the Israeli market relied heavily on basic cotton weaves. The focus was primarily on raw durability, with black shirt fabric being a staple for the growing service sector, though it often lacked thermal regulation.

Entering the 2010s, the integration of synthetic blends revolutionized the market. The introduction of advanced chemical finishing allowed for better wrinkle resistance and the emergence of sophisticated lining solutions to improve the drape of luxury garments.

By 2020, the trajectory shifted toward "Climate-Adaptive" textiles. The focus moved from mere aesthetics to functional performance, integrating reflective coatings and nano-fibers to combat the intense solar radiation of the region.

Common Questions in Israel Market

Expert answers regarding fabric selection and performance in hot climates.

Which black shirt fabric is best for high humidity in Tel Aviv?

We recommend a high-twist cotton-polyester blend that provides the sharp look of traditional black shirts but offers significantly higher breathability and quicker drying times.

How does heat reflective lining fabric improve comfort in summer?

Our reflective linings use micro-mirrors to bounce infrared radiation away from the body, reducing the internal garment temperature by up to 3-5 degrees Celsius.

Is acetate lining fabric better than polyester for luxury suits?

Yes, acetate is more breathable and has a superior moisture-absorption rate compared to standard polyester, making it ideal for the warm Israeli climate.

Can chiffon lining fabric be used for modest clothing layering?

Absolutely. It is specifically designed to provide opacity for modest wear while remaining incredibly lightweight to prevent overheating during layering.

What are the main durability factors for garment fabric in the Middle East?

The primary factors are UV resistance and salt-air corrosion resistance, especially for coastal cities. Our fabrics are treated with UV-stabilizers to prevent fading.
